Transaction 86577db28a2e253ead2b00f0933971d7cea163e0101227573733aa671f1ce219

2 Input
2 Outputs
  • 86577db28a2e253ead2b00f0933971d7cea163e0101227573733aa671f1ce219:0
  • value  539099
    address  1PscaxnQC7zcnbnWDUr7DP5F8mtcS5NPGR
  • 86577db28a2e253ead2b00f0933971d7cea163e0101227573733aa671f1ce219:1
  • value  21057300
    address  39pdt3RjTYibZiKrhPCLDk9Cr1xUviUntu